B0336: B0336: Airbag System - Deployment Sensor Circuit Malfunction
on 2018 BMW X5

📖 What Does B0336 Mean on 2018 BMW X5?
Symptoms
- • Airbag warning light on dashboard
- • airbag system malfunction message on display
- • possible airbag deployment failure in a crash
Common Causes
- • Faulty deployment sensor
- • wiring damage
- • connector corrosion
- • airbag control module malfunction
How to Fix B0336 on 2018 BMW X5
1. Disconnect the battery to prevent accidental airbag deployment. 2. Check the deployment sensor circuit for damage or corrosion. 3. Replace the deployment sensor if damaged. 4. Inspect and clean the wiring and connectors. 5. Update the airbag control module software if necessary. 6. Test the airbag system to ensure proper function.
